Texas A&M-Corpus Christi Inspires Young Scientists with OCEANS Program

CORPUS CHRISTI, Texas – On Tuesday afternoons, the peaceful and still waters of Laguna Madre are set upon by a gaggle of rambunctious, eager middle-schoolers in kayaks — all poised to observe, collect, and learn from their surroundings. These budding young citizen scientists are participants of the OCEANS (Oceanography, Conservation, Ecology, Arts, Nature, and Stewardship) program — a recent recipient of a $471,921grant from the prestigious National Academy of Science, and the most recent product of the passion-driven, highly successful, collaboration between Texas A&M University-Corpus Christi, Flour Bluff Independent School District (FBISD), and Friends of Redhead Pond and Environmental Stewardship Association (FRP).

Located on the Encinal Peninsula of Corpus Christi, and in possession of 60 acres of Environmental Education Area, FBISD includes a diverse student population — of whom 43.9% identify as Hispanic. With 54% of all FBISD students living in economically disadvantaged homes, and with no institutionally-coordinated curriculum to consistently integrate STEM topics between kindergarten and eighth grade, 44% of these students have been categorized as being “at risk” of not continuing their education.

Fortunately, a series of successful collaborations between TAMU-CC Assistant Professor of Marine Biology Dr. Dara Orbach, and Flour Bluff educator and marine advocate Katie Doyle, has led to Flour Bluff students being in the unique position of undertaking fieldwork under the guidance and mentorship of TAMU-CC experts and students.

This new partnership has resulted in the inception of the OCEANS program, a 30-month pilot program involving up to 400 Flour Bluff students in place-based learning, enhancing environmental literacy and STEM interest. Local community leaders and TAMU-CC STEM students, overseen by the three project leaders and a post-doctoral researcher, will mentor these younger students in scientific practices and conservation techniques. The program includes an art component, physical activities like field trips, water sports, and beach cleanups, as well as citizen science and community engagement.

Under the direction of Dr. Larisa Ford, President of FRP, observations and outcomes of the OCEANS program will be incorporated into a draft Environmental Stewardship and Literacy Plan for the Flour Bluff community and decision-makers to take action to safeguard the area’s ecosystem.

“Conservation is something that occupies the thoughts of many young people now, and community leaders need to know how much they want to help — especially in their own backyards, and yet, they are often overlooked,” Ford said. “We want to stop this disconnect.”

The team also believes there is potential for other schools in unique ecological areas to adapt the program for their students.
